Where is the Geigerman family from?

You can see how Geigerman families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Geigerman family name was found in the USA between 1880 and 1920. The most Geigerman families were found in USA in 1880. In 1880 there were 10 Geigerman families living in New York. This was about 67% of all the recorded Geigerman's in USA. New York had the highest population of Geigerman families in 1880.

What did your Geigerman 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Traveling Salesman was the top reported job for people in the USA named Geigerman. 50% of Geigerman men worked as a Traveling Salesman.

What is the average Geigerman lifespan?

Between 1964 and 2004, in the United States, Geigerman life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1979, and highest in 1997. The average life expectancy for Geigerman in 1964 was 75, and 73 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Geigerman 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
